Silicone Material Basics

Silicone kitchen tools are popular for their versatility and durability. Understanding silicone’s basics helps in knowing its safety for cooking. This section delves into what silicone is, how it is made, and its common uses in kitchenware.

What Is Silicone?

Silicone is a synthetic polymer made from silicon, oxygen, and other elements. It is known for its flexibility, heat resistance, and non-stick properties. These characteristics make it ideal for kitchen tools.

How Silicone Is Made

Silicone production starts with silicon extracted from silica. The silicon undergoes a chemical process, turning it into silicone. This process involves combining silicon with carbon and other elements. The result is a durable, flexible material.

Common Uses In Kitchenware

Silicone is widely used in various kitchen tools. You’ll find it in spatulas, baking mats, and molds. It is also common in pot holders and ice cube trays. Its heat resistance makes it suitable for cookware and bakeware.

Safety Of Silicone Kitchen Tools

Silicone kitchen tools have gained popularity due to their versatility and convenience. Many home cooks and professional chefs choose silicone for its flexible nature. But is silicone really safe to use in the kitchen? Understanding the safety aspects of silicone kitchen tools is crucial for informed choices.

Temperature Resistance

Silicone kitchen tools can withstand high temperatures. They are safe up to 500 degrees Fahrenheit. This makes them ideal for baking and cooking. Silicone won’t melt or warp under high heat. This ensures your food remains uncontaminated. Using silicone tools reduces the risk of burns. They cool down quickly after use.

Chemical Stability

Silicone is chemically stable. It doesn’t react with food or other substances. This prevents unwanted flavors or chemicals in your meals. Silicone is non-toxic and inert. It doesn’t release harmful fumes when heated. This stability makes it a safe choice for cooking.

Food Safety Standards

Silicone kitchen tools often meet strict food safety standards. They are usually BPA-free, which is important for health. Manufacturers design these tools to be food-grade. This ensures no harmful chemicals leach into food. Always check labels for safety certifications. This guarantees you are using a safe product.

Concerns And Misconceptions

Silicone kitchen tools have become popular in many homes. Yet, concerns and misconceptions about their safety linger. People often wonder if these tools are harmful. Some worry about health risks. Others consider environmental effects. Quality differences also raise questions. Let’s explore these concerns.

Potential Health Risks

Many worry about chemicals in silicone. They fear these might leak into food. Studies show silicone is stable and safe. It doesn’t react with food. High-quality silicone tools withstand high temperatures. This means they don’t melt or release toxins.

Environmental Impact

Some view silicone as non-eco-friendly. Unlike plastic, silicone is more durable. It lasts longer and reduces waste. Though not biodegradable, it can be recycled. This makes it a better choice over disposable plastics. Using silicone helps lessen landfill waste.

Quality Variations

Not all silicone tools are the same. Quality varies from brand to brand. Some use fillers in their products. These fillers may affect safety and durability. Pure silicone is flexible and strong. Checking labels ensures you choose high-quality tools. Investing in good quality means they last longer.

Comparing Silicone To Other Materials

Choosing the right kitchen tools can be overwhelming with the variety of materials available. Silicone, a popular choice, often competes with plastic, metal, and wood. Each material has its unique advantages, but understanding their differences can help you make informed decisions. What makes silicone stand out, and how does it compare to other materials commonly used in kitchen tools?

Silicone Vs. Plastic

Silicone is flexible and can withstand high temperatures, unlike many plastics which can melt or warp. This makes silicone ideal for baking or cooking at high heat. Have you ever had a plastic spatula melt on a hot pan? Silicone eliminates that worry.

Moreover, silicone is non-toxic and odorless, while plastic may release harmful chemicals when exposed to heat. If safety is your priority, silicone is the better choice. Consider the longevity of your kitchen tools. Silicone doesn’t degrade as quickly as plastic, ensuring your investment lasts longer.

Silicone Vs. Metal

Metal tools are incredibly durable but lack the flexibility and softness that silicone offers. Silicone is gentle on cookware, reducing scratches and preserving non-stick surfaces. Do you cringe when you hear metal scraping against your favorite pan? Silicone saves you from that sound.

Metal tools can conduct heat, making them uncomfortable to handle without protection. Silicone, on the other hand, remains cool to the touch. If you enjoy cooking without worrying about burns, silicone is a safer option.

Silicone Vs. Wood

Wood has a timeless, rustic appeal and is gentle on cookware. However, it can absorb odors and colors from foods. Silicone, being non-porous, resists stains and odors, keeping your tools looking fresh. Have you ever noticed your wooden spoon turning orange after stirring a tomato sauce? Silicone prevents such discoloration.

Wood can also harbor bacteria if not properly maintained. Silicone is easy to clean and can be sanitized in the dishwasher, offering a more hygienic solution. If cleanliness is important to you, silicone may be the better option.

Choosing Safe Silicone Products

Silicone kitchen tools offer a safe alternative to traditional materials. They resist heat and don’t leach chemicals. Choose high-quality, food-grade silicone to ensure safety and durability.

Choosing safe silicone kitchen tools is essential for health and peace of mind. Not all silicone products are created equal. Some may contain harmful fillers. Knowing what to look for ensures safety in the kitchen. Here are some guidelines to help you make informed choices.

Identifying Quality Silicone

High-quality silicone feels firm, not sticky. It should have a smooth, even color. Avoid products with a strong chemical smell. This may indicate the presence of unwanted additives. Pure silicone is more durable and long-lasting. It withstands high temperatures without breaking down. Inspect the product for any signs of wear or discoloration.

Checking Certifications

Check for FDA or LFGB certifications. These ensure the product meets safety standards. Certified silicone is tested for harmful chemicals. These certifications offer peace of mind. They confirm that the silicone is food-grade. Look for labels on the product or packaging. This helps in verifying its safety.

Tips For Safe Use

Before using, wash silicone tools thoroughly. Use warm water and mild soap. Avoid harsh cleaners which can damage the silicone. Check for cracks or tears regularly. Damaged tools can harbor bacteria. Avoid using silicone on direct flames. It may cause the material to degrade. Store in a dry, cool place to maintain its quality.

Frequently Asked Questions

Are Silicone Kitchen Utensils Toxic Free?

Silicone kitchen utensils are generally non-toxic and safe for cooking. They withstand high temperatures without leaching chemicals. Always choose food-grade silicone for safety. Check for certifications and avoid utensils with added fillers. Proper care ensures longevity and safety in your kitchen.

Are Silicone Kitchen Tools Good Or Bad?

Silicone kitchen tools are durable, heat-resistant, and non-stick. They are safe for cooking and easy to clean. Silicone is non-toxic and doesn’t react with food. Choose high-quality silicone to avoid any potential harmful chemicals. Overall, silicone tools are a good choice for most cooking needs.

What Is The Safest Material For Kitchen Tools?

Stainless steel is the safest material for kitchen tools. It resists corrosion, doesn’t react with food, and is durable. Silicone is also safe and heat-resistant, making it ideal for non-stick cookware. Both materials are easy to clean and maintain, ensuring safe food preparation.

Do Silicone Utensils Leach Microplastics?

Silicone utensils generally don’t leach microplastics. They are stable and safe for cooking. Choose high-quality silicone products to ensure safety. Regularly inspect utensils for damage to maintain quality. Silicone is a reliable choice for eco-friendly kitchens, minimizing plastic pollution risks.
